Badia
Badia Cinnamon Sugar; 29 Ounces; 6 Per Case
Badia Cinnamon Sugar; 29 Ounces; 6 Per Case
SKU:D-699028
Regular price
$40.39
Regular price
Sale price
$40.39
Unit price
/
per